What was the main effect of the Great Migration ?.

Answers

In the North, the Great Migration gave rise to the first sizable urban black communities. Between 1910 and 1930, the black population in the North increased by around 20%.

What was Great Migration?

Six million African Americans left the rural Southern United States and moved to the urban Northeast, Midwest, and West during the Great Migration, also known as the Great Northward Migration or the Black Migration, which took place between 1910 and 1970. It was mostly brought on by the deplorable economic circ*mstances that African Americans experienced, as well as the pervasive racial discrimination and segregation that existed in the Southern states where Jim Crow laws were implemented. A portion of the refugees were particularly motivated by the ongoing lynchings of African Americans who were looking for social relief. Because most migrants migrated to the nation's main cities at a time when those cities had a disproportionate amount of cultural, social, political, and economic influence over the country, migration's historic impact was enhanced.

What are the adaptations of Hamlet?.

Answers

Since 1900, more than fifty movies have been based on Hamlet by William Shakespeare. There have been seven post-World War II theatrical releases of Hamlet: Laurence Olivier's Hamlet from 1948; Grigori Kozintsev's Russian adaptation from 1964; Richard Burton's Hamlet, a film of the 1964 Broadway production directed by John Gielgud, which had limited engagements that year; Tony Richardson's 1969 version (the first in colour), starring Nicol Williamson as Hamlet and Anthony Hopkins as Claudius; Franco Zeffirelli's 1990 version

The first post-war movie to adapt the Hamlet story was Edgar G. Ulmer's Strange Illusion, one of the first movies to concentrate on the psychology of a young character. The West German director Helmut Käutner used Hamlet as the basis for his story Der Rest ist Schweigen (The Rest is Silence), and the Japanese director Akira Kurosawa used it for Warui Yatsu Hodo Yoku Nemuru, both of which deal with civil corruption (The Bad Sleep Well). The main character, Yvan, in Claude Chabrol's Ophélia (France, 1962), sees Olivier's Hamlet and mistakenly believes—with tragic results—that he is in Hamlet's position. Johnny Hamlet, a spaghetti western adaptation, was helmed by Enzo Castellari in 1968.

Strange Brew (1983), Hamlet Liikemaailmassa (Hamlet Goes Business) (Finland, 1987), Rosencrantz & Guildenstern Are Dead (1990), Tardid (The Doubt), a 2009 Iranian film directed and written by Varuzh Karim Masihi, Haider (2014), a 2014 Bollywood film directed and written by Vishal Bhardwaj, and Ophelia (2018), which follows the story of Hamlet from Ophelia's perspective are other adaptations of Hamlet.

When we experience an unpleasant state of tension between two or more conflicting thoughts, we are experiencing.

Answers

Cognitive dissonance is the uncomfortable situation that results when two or more of our thoughts are at odds with one another. The right response in this case is option D.

You experience cognitive dissonance when your beliefs and behavior are in conflict. It can be disturbing when people have divergent opinions, attitudes, or views towards the same subject.

One example of cognitive dissonance is the fact that many individuals smoke while knowing it is detrimental for their health. The contradiction will be more noticeable in those who give their health a high priority.

Having to choose between conflicting options, putting effort into the aim, and being required to comply with something against one's convictions are all examples of cognitive dissonance triggers.

In keeping with the social cognitive emphasis on the person's cognitive abilities and mental states, Mischel conceptualized personality as a set of interconnected cognitive affective processing systems, also known as the ___ model
Cognitive affecting processing

Answers

The Cognitive Affective Processing Model, developed by Mischel, was a framework for understanding personality as a collection of interconnected cognitive affective processing systems.

What is Cognitive Affective?
Walter Mischel and Yuichi Shoda's 1995 proposal of the cognitive-affective personality system, also known as the cognitive-affective processing system (CAPS), is a contribution to a psychology of personality. According to the cognitive-affective model, the best way to predict behaviour is to have a thorough understanding of the person, the situation, as well as how the person and situation interact. According to cognitive-affective theorists, behaviour doesn't stem from an overarching personality trait but rather from how people perceive themselves in a given circ*mstance. Consistent patterns of variation inside the person can be seen in inconsistent behaviours, which are not solely a result of the situation.

which of the following commands removes a job from the at queue? (select two. each answer is an independent solution.)

Answers

The atrm order eliminates occupations that were made with the at order. The atrm command tries to remove only those jobs if one or more job numbers are specified. All jobs belonging to those users are removed if one or more user names are specified.

In Linux, what is the atrm command?

The atrm command is used to get rid of the jobs you specify. The command passes the job number to remove a job. Only the jobs that belong to the user can be deleted. Any job that belongs to another user can only be deleted by the superuser.

How do I get rid of all Linux jobs?

All jobs you have submitted are removed using the command atrm -;It is useful for completely clearing your queue. Use at -l instead of atq to list your jobs and at -r instead of atrm to delete them in some versions.
